FIPA Group launches first Maiora 33FB superyacht

7 June 2016 • Written by Chris Jefferies

Italian yard FIPA Group has launched the first hull in its Maiora 33FB superyacht range.

Splashed this morning (June 7) in Viareggio, the new 33 metre arrival features a deep-vee planing fibreglass hull, which can deliver an estimated top speed of 28 knots.

Styled in-house by the Maiora Yachts team, the 33FB features a bright and airy saloon with large windows to let in plenty of natural light. Warm tones are achieved by contrasting the dark oak floor with dove grey wall linings and light fabrics.

The owner’s suite on the 33FB is situated to the fore of the main deck and is stretched across the full 6.8 metre beam. The central feature of this cabin is a geometric headboard design that sets the tone for a sophisticated environment throughout.

The layout below decks comprises two VIP suites and two twin guest cabins, while the bow-end crew quarters are accessed via the galley and include three further cabins.

External spaces are plentiful with a large flybridge sofa and full-size bar on the upper deck shaded by a chunky hardtop bimini. What’s more, a pair of sunbeds can emerge from underneath a hatch in the foredeck to create further lounging space.

Power comes from a pair of 2,600hp MTU M93 engines, and Maiora Yachts adds that the 33FB has been designed to cruise comfortably at a speed of 24 knots.

Upcoming projects from Maiora Yachts include the M40 and the M46, which would take over from the M43 as the flagship of the range.
